1Helicobacter pylori infection: Beyond gastric manifestations显示文摘Helicobacter pylori(H.pylori)is a bacterium that infects more than a half of world’s population.Although it is mainly related to the development of gastroduodenal diseases,several studies have shown that such infection may also influence the development and severity of various extragastric diseases.According to the current evidence,whereas this bacterium is a risk factor for some of these manifestations,it might play a protective role in other pathological conditions.In that context,when considered the gastrointestinal tract,H.pylori positivity have been related to Inflammatory Bowel Disease,Gastroesophageal Reflux Disease,Non-Alcoholic Fatty Liver Disease,Hepatic Carcinoma,Cholelithiasis,and Cholecystitis.Moreover,lower serum levels of iron and vitamin B12 have been found in patients with H.pylori infection,leading to the emergence of anemias in a portion of them.With regards to neurological manifestations,a growing number of studies have associated that bacterium with multiple sclerosis,Alzheimer’s disease,Parkinson’s disease,and Guillain-Barrésyndrome.Interestingly,the risk of developing cardiovascular disorders,such as atherosclerosis,is also influenced by the infection.Besides that,the H.pylori-associated inflammation may also lead to increased insulin resistance,leading to a higher risk of diabetes mellitus among infected individuals.Finally,the occurrence of dermatological and ophthalmic disorders have also been related to that microorganism.In this sense,this minireview aims to gather the main studies associating H.pylori infection with extragastric conditions,and also to explore the main mechanisms that may explain the role of H.pylori in those diseases.Maria Luisa Cordeiro Santos Breno Bittencourt de Brito Filipe Antonio França da Silva Mariana Miranda Sampaio Hanna Santos Marques Natalia Oliveira e Silva Dulciene Maria de Magalhaes Queiroz Fabricio Freire de Melo 2020World Journal of Gastroenterology2020,26,28:34
2Cytokines,cytokine gene polymorphisms and Helicobacter pylori infection:Friend or foe?显示文摘Helicobacter pylori(H.pylori)is a flagellated,spiralshaped,microaerophilic Gram-negative bacillus that colonises the gastric mucosa of more than 50%of the human population.Infection is a risk factor for gastritis,ulcer disease and stomach cancer.Immunity against H.pylori is mainly related to Th1/Th17 skewing,and the activation of regulatory T cells is the main strategy used to limit inflammatory responses,which can result in the pathogen persistence and can lead to chronic gastrointestinal diseases,including cancer.Furthermore,host genetic factors that affect cytokines may determine differences in the susceptibility to many diseases.In this review,we present the cytokine profiles and the main cytokine gene polymorphisms associated with resistance/susceptibility to H.pylori and discuss how such polymorphisms may influence infection/disease outcomes.Camila A Figueiredo Cintia Rodrigues Marques Ryan dos Santos Costa Hugo Bernardino F da Silva Neuza M Alcantara-Neves 2014World Journal of Gastroenterology2014,20,18:11
3Open abdomen in gastrointestinal surgery:Which technique is the best for temporary closure during damage control?显示文摘AIM To compare the 3 main techniques of temporary closure of the abdominal cavity,vacuum assisted closure(vacuum-assisted closure therapy- VAC),Bogota bag and Barker technique,in damage control surgery.METHODS After systematic review of the literature,33 articles were selected to compare the efficiency of the three procedures.Criteria such as cost,infections,capacity of reconstruction of the abdominal wall,diseases associated with the technique,among others were analyzed.RESULTS The Bogota bag and Barker techniques present as advantage the availability of material and low cost,what is not observed in the VAC procedure.The VAC technique is the most efficient,not only because it reduces the tension on the boarders of the lesion,but also removes stagnant fluids and debris and acts at cellular level increasing cell proliferation and division.Bogota bag presents the higher rates of skin laceration and evisceration,greater need for a stent for draining fluids and wash-ups,higher rates of intestinal adhesion to the abdominal wall.The Barker technique presents lack of efficiency in closing the abdominal wall and difficulty on maintaining pressure on the dressing.The VAC dressing can generate irritation and dermatitis when the drape is applied,in addition to pain,infection and bleeding,as well as toxic shock syndrome,anaerobic sepsis and thrombosis.CONCLUSION The VAC technique,showed to be superior allowing a better control of liquid on the third space,avoiding complications such as fistula with small mortality,low infection rate,and easier capability on primary closure of the abdominal cavity.Marcelo A F Ribeiro Junior Emily Alves Barros Sabrina Marques de Carvalho Vinicius Pereira Nascimento José Cruvinel Neto Alexandre Zanchenko Fonseca 2016World Journal of Gastrointestinal Surgery2016,8,8:9

5Relationship between Th17 immune response and cancer显示文摘Cancer is the second leading cause of death worldwide and epidemiological projections predict growing cancer mortality rates in the next decades.Cancer has a close relationship with the immune system and,although Th17 cells are known to play roles in the immune response against microorganisms and in autoimmunity,studies have emphasized their roles in cancer pathogenesis.The Th17 immune response profile is involved in several types of cancer including urogenital,respiratory,gastrointestinal,and skin cancers.This type of immune response exerts pro and antitumor functions through several mechanisms,depending on the context of each tumor,including the protumor angiogenesis and exhaustion of T cells and the antitumor recruitment of T cells and neutrophils to the tumor microenvironment.Among other factors,the paradoxical behavior of Th17 cells in this setting has been attributed to its plasticity potential,which makes possible their conversion into other types of T cells such as Th17/Treg and Th17/Th1 cells.Interleukin(IL)-17 stands out among Th17-related cytokines since it modulates pathways and interacts with other cell profiles in the tumor microenvironment,which allow Th17 cells to prevail in tumors.Moreover,the IL-17 is able to mediate pro and antitumor processes that influence the development and progression of various cancers,being associated with variable clinical outcomes.The understanding of the relationship between the Th17 immune response and cancer as well as the singularities of carcinogenic processes in each type of tumor is crucial for the identification of new therapeutic targets.Hanna Santos Marques Breno Bittencourt de Brito Filipe Antônio França da Silva Maria Luísa Cordeiro Santos Júlio César Braga de Souza Thiago Macêdo Lopes Correia Luana Weber Lopes Nayara Silva de Macêdo Neres Rafael Santos Dantas Miranda Dórea Anna Carolina Saúde Dantas Lorena Lôbo Brito Morbeck Iasmin Souza Lima Amanda Alves de Almeida Maiara Raulina de Jesus Dias Fabrício Freire de Melo 2021World Journal of Clinical Oncology2021,12,10:5
6Chronic myeloid leukemia-from the Philadelphia chromosome to specific target drugs:A literature review显示文摘Chronic myeloid leukemia(CML)is a myeloproliferative neoplasm and was the first neoplastic disease associated with a well-defined genotypic anomaly―the presence of the Philadelphia chromosome.The advances in cytogenetic and molecular assays are of great importance to the diagnosis,prognosis,treatment,and monitoring of CML.The discovery of the breakpoint cluster region(BCR)-Abelson murine leukemia(ABL)1 fusion oncogene has revolutionized the treatment of CML patients by allowing the development of targeted drugs that inhibit the tyrosine kinase activity of the BCR-ABL oncoprotein.Tyrosine kinase inhibitors(known as TKIs)are the standard therapy for CML and greatly increase the survival rates,despite adverse effects and the odds of residual disease after discontinuation of treatment.As therapeutic alternatives,the subsequent TKIs lead to faster and deeper molecular remissions;however,with the emergence of resistance to these drugs,immunotherapy appears as an alternative,which may have a cure potential in these patients.Against this background,this article aims at providing an overview on CML clinical management and a summary on the main targeted drugs available in that context.Mariana Miranda Sampaio Maria Luísa Cordeiro Santos Hanna Santos Marques Vinícius Lima de Souza Gonçalves Glauber Rocha Lima Araújo Luana Weber Lopes Jonathan Santos Apolonio Camilo Santana Silva Luana Kauany de SáSantos Beatriz Rocha Cuzzuol Quézia Estéfani Silva Guimarães Mariana Novaes Santos Breno Bittencourt de Brito Filipe Antônio França da Silva Márcio Vasconcelos Oliveira Cláudio Lima Souza Fabrício Freire de Melo 2021World Journal of Clinical Oncology2021,12,2:3
7Molecular approaches for spinal cord injury treatment显示文摘Injuries to the spinal cord result in permanent disabilities that limit daily life activities.The main reasons for these poor outcomes are the limited regenerative capacity of central neurons and the inhibitory milieu that is established upon traumatic injuries.Despite decades of research,there is still no efficient treatment for spinal cord injury.Many strategies are tested in preclinical studies that focus on ameliorating the functional outcomes after spinal cord injury.Among these,molecular compounds are currently being used for neurological recovery,with promising results.These molecules target the axon collapsed growth cone,the inhibitory microenvironment,the survival of neurons and glial cells,and the re-establishment of lost connections.In this review we focused on molecules that are being used,either in preclinical or clinical studies,to treat spinal cord injuries,such as drugs,growth and neurotrophic factors,enzymes,and purines.The mechanisms of action of these molecules are discussed,considering traumatic spinal cord injury in rodents and humans.Fernanda Martins de Almeida Suelen Adriani Marques Anne Caroline Rodrigues dos Santos Caio Andrade Prins Fellipe Soares dos Santos Cardoso Luiza dos Santos Heringer Henrique Rocha Mendonça Ana Maria Blanco Martinez 2023Neural Regeneration Research2023,18,1:3

9Client-level predictors of treatment engagement,outcome and dropout:moving beyond demographics显示文摘Background Despite the availability of evidence-based treatments for posttraumatic stress disorder(PTSD),significant heterogeneity in the effectiveness of PTSD treatment persists,especially in community settings.Client demographics used to understand this variability in treatment outcome and dropout have yielded mixed results.Despite increasing evidence for the importance of attending to treatment engagement in community settings,few studies have explored client-level predictors.Aim The purpose of this study is to explore client-level predictors of treatment outcome and dropout beyond client demographics,and to identify client-level predictors of treatment engagement in community settings.Method Secondary data analysis was conducted with data collected as part of an implementation-effectiveness hybrid study of cognitive processing therapy(CPT)for PTSD in a diverse community healthcentre.Providers(n=19)treated(n=52)clients as part of their routine clinical care.Non-demographic client-level predictors included barriers to treatment,quality of life,session-level language and employment history assessed at baseline.Treatment engagement included number of weeks in the study,number of sessions with repeated CPT content,number of unique CPT sessions attended,frequency of session attendance and consistency of session attendance.Results Results showed language as a significant predictor of treatment engagement.There were significant differences between Spanish and English-speaking clients,with the former having a tendency to repeat more session content than the latter(β=1.4 sessions,p=0.003),and also less likely to attend treatment frequently(r=0.62,p=0.009)and consistently(r=0.57,p=0.027)if high logistical and financial barriers were endorsed.Irrespective of language,clients who reported high quality of life at baseline were less likely to repeat CPT session content(β=-0.3,p=0.04),and those with increased baseline barriers to treatment had deceleration in PTSD symptom improvement over time(β=-0.62,p<0.05).In terms of treatment engagement moderators impacting treatment outcome,clients who repeated more session content were more likely to complete treatment(0R=1.84,p=0.037).Conclusion Identification of client-level predictors of treatment engagement,outcome and dropout is essential to optimise treatment,particularly in community settings.Soo-jeong Youn Margaret-Anne Mackintosh Shannon Wiltsey Stirman Kay lie A Patrick Yesenia Aguilar Silvan Anna D Bartuska Derri L Shtasel Luana Marques 2019General Psychiatry2019,32,6:2
10Helicobacter pylori infection:How does age influence the inflammatory pattern?显示文摘The inflammatory pattern during Helicobacter pylori(H.pylori)infection is changeable and complex.During childhood,it is possible to observe a predominantly regulatory response,evidenced by high concentrations of key cytokines for the maintenance of Treg responses such as TGF-β1 and IL-10,in addition to high expression of the transcription factor FOXP3.On the other hand,there is a predominance of cytokines associated with the Th1 and Th17 responses among H.pylori-positive adults.In the last few years,the participation of the Th17 response in the gastric inflammation against H.pylori infection has been highlighted due to the high levels of TGF-β1 and IL-17 found in this infectious scenario,and growing evidence has supported a close relationship between this immune response profile and unfavorable outcomes related to the infection.Moreover,this cytokine profile might play a pivotal role in the effectiveness of anti-H.pylori vaccines.It is evident that age is one of the main factors influencing the gastric inflammatory pattern during the infection with H.pylori,and understanding the immune response against the bacterium can assist in the development of alternative prophylactic and therapeutic strategies against the infection as well as in the comprehension of the pathogenesis of the outcomes related to that microorganism.Glauber Rocha Lima Araújo Hanna Santos Marques Maria Luísa Cordeiro Santos Filipe Antônio França daSilva Breno Bittencourt da Brito Gabriel Lima Correa Santos Fabrício Freire de Melo 2022World Journal of Gastroenterology2022,28,4:2

12Non-pharmacological management of pediatric functional abdominal pain disorders:Current evidence and future perspectives显示文摘Functional abdominal pain disorders(FAPDs) are an important and prevalent cause of functional gastrointestinal disorders among children, encompassing the diagnoses of functional dyspepsia, irritable bowel syndrome, abdominal migraine, and the one not previously present in Rome Ⅲ, functional abdominal pain not otherwise specified. In the absence of sufficiently effective and safe pharmacological treatments for this public problem, non-pharmacological therapies emerge as a viable means of treating these patients, avoiding not only possible side effects, but also unnecessary prescription, since many of the pharmacological treatments prescribed do not have good efficacy when compared to placebo. Thus, the present study provides a review of current and relevant evidence on non-pharmacological management of FAPDs, covering the most commonly indicated treatments, from cognitive behavioral therapy to meditation, acupuncture, yoga, massage, spinal manipulation, moxibustion, and physical activities. In addition, this article also analyzes the quality of publications in the area, assessing whether it is possible to state if non-pharmacological therapies are viable, safe, and sufficiently well-based for an appropriate and effective prescription of these treatments. Finally, it is possible to observe an increase not only in the number of publications on the non-pharmacological treatments for FAPDs in recent years, but also an increase in the quality of these publications. Finally, the sample selection of satisfactory age groups in these studies enables the formulation of specific guidelines for this age group, thus avoiding the need for adaptation of prescriptions initially made for adults, but for children use.Maria Luísa Cordeiro Santos Ronaldo Teixeira da Silva Júnior Breno Bittencourt de Brito Filipe Antônio França da Silva Hanna Santos Marques Vinícius Lima de SouzaGonçalves Talita Costa dos Santos Carolina Ladeia Cirne Natália Oliveira e Silva Márcio Vasconcelos Oliveira Fabrício Freire de Melo 2022World Journal of Clinical Pediatrics2022,11,2:2
